tips for run stopping
I need help stopping the I form one wr outside runs. I've tried using the 3-4 and that 4-6 outside lb blitz, but it seems to not work because he gets outside everytime with ray rice. I need to know some good plays to use to stop the outside run because his passing game is trash but ray rice is killing me. I currently use the jets pb, but any other 3-4 pb suggestion with be accepted.

Try going with some of the QB Contain plays...
They will give you man coverage which stops the run better than zones, along with Contain assignments that prevent the runner from getting outside, and a spy that will try to shoot the gap when the ball is handed off. If you'd rather not go that route, you can add a contain assignment to any defense by selecting a defender and A/X (360/PS3 respectively) and the left stick down. Another way to attack outside runs is with a SKY coverage that sends a high safety to the flats. The safety will head to the flats but unlike the defenders that are already near the LOS, he won't have to fight off blockers. Even if he doesn't make the play, he can funnel the runner back to pursuit. Hope this helps.... Later

Its all about alignment and execution to stop the run.
Shift your linebackers to the strong side of the formation. (Tight end side) Shift your d line to the weak side and Contain your weakside defensive end to counter a cutback, or playmaker run to that side. Cover 3 zone is good against outside runs if you shift your linebackers to the side of the run play. Cover 4 zone is excellent against the run because BOTH safeties can help out if they have high awareness. A lot of people dont know how to use cover 4 zone to stop the run, but cover 4 can be very effective. Just a few tips. But all in all, shifting linebackers to the strong side is what counts. And shift your d-line to the weak side. |

I'm not very good w/ the 3-4 but I have had some luck stopping the outside run game w/ the 46. I manually control the LB and speed/sprint to the outide to contain the HB back to the middle of the field. It doesn't always stop them but it limits the huge gain.
46 bear cover 1 works well, just beware of the pass, cover 1 might not work so well. If he doesn't pass then it should be ok. It looks like the Jets have the 46 normal. I would try the 46 normal cover 1. Control the LB that isn't blitzing and get him oustide fast. You can flip this play at the play call menu or on the field to adjust to your opponent. Good luck!
